Melatonin Gummy Dosage

Whether you’re new to melatonin or are a veteran where this supplement is concerned, you may be wondering, “How many melatonin gummies should I take?”. Melatonin is a hormone that’s produced in the brain when it becomes dark. Researchers think that melatonin plays other important roles in the body, but it still requires further study. Melatonin can be made from animals, microorganisms, or in a lab. While primarily used as a sleep aid, people use melatonin to help with jet lag, sleep disorders, and anxiety, like before surgery.

Is Chili Good For Metabolism?

Chilies are some of the most popular spices in the world. Chilies are both a food and a spice, or more accurately, a food that is used as a spice. Grown in warmer climates, chilis are integrated into the food of many cultures around the world. Jamaica, for example, is famous for using one of the hottest chilies around, the scotch bonnet.
